Public Workshop of the Committee on the Return of Individual-Specific Research Results Generated in Research Laboratories
National Academies of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ine
Main Building, Lecture Room
September 6-7, 2017
Public Workshop
Public Workshop Objectives:
- Explore current practices and key considerations in the return of individual-specific research results (ROR) including,
- Participant preferences and implications for informed consent.
- The benefits and risks associated with the return of research in different contexts.
- Logistical and operational implications for researchers, institutions, and participants.
- State and federal legal and regulatory policies relevant to the ROR and how they present real or perceived barriers.
- The identification of communication strategies for the appropriate and effective ROR.
- Identify the circumstances under which ROR might be appropriately performed.
